'''Ludum''' ''(pronounced loo-dum)'' is a term for a relationship that appears like a "[[straight]]" couple, or "[[Straight passing|passes as a straight couple]]", where one person looks like a [[man]] and the other looks like a [[woman]], but in reality one or both partners do not identify as a [[straight]] and are not [[cisgender]]. This includes...
* One or both partners being [[Non-Binary|non-binary]].
* One or both partners being [[transgender]], and being misgendered.
*One or both partners being [[anonbinary]].
Ludum is a description for a relationship type, not an identity. The creator requested that ''only'' those who are [[cisn't]] use this term.
== History ==
The term was coined by Vasilisa through beyond-mogai-pride-flags Tumblr account on June 3rd of 2018.
== Flag ==
The flag was coined by Vasilisa through beyond-mogai-pride-flags Tumblr account on June 3rd of 2018. It has no confirmed meaning.
